The Reserve Bank of India (RBI) has, by an order dated May 09, 2025, imposed a monetary penalty of ₹50,000/- (Rupees Fifty Thousand only) on Swarna Bharathi Sahakara Bank Niyamitha, Bangalore, Karnataka (the bank) for contravention of provisions of Section 31 read with Section 56 of the Banking Regulation Act, 1949 (BR Act). This penalty has been imposed in exercise of powers conferred on RBI under the provisions of Section 47A(1)(c) read with Sections 46(4)(i) and 56 of the BR Act. The 615th meeting of the Central Board of Directors of Reserve Bank of India was held today in Mumbai under the Chairmanship of Shri Sanjay Malhotra, Governor. As part of the agenda, inter alia, the Board reviewed the Economic Capital Framework (ECF) of the Reserve Bank of India.
